Yes. Pretty much.

This is how it goes.

You do 5man HCs, get upgrades, do all of the ICC 5man instances (Pit of Saron, Halls of reflection, the Forge of Souls).

You will be getting Justice points from these runs, use them to buy gear from the JP vendors located in Dalaran (ask gaurd).

Once you have an avergae iLvl of 232-245 you can jump into TOC or even ICC 10 nowadays.

Thats it.

As for when Cataclysm comes:

You do 5 mans normal instances to gear for HC instances.

You craft gear to skip normal instances and jump into HCs.

You gear in HCs to do the first tier of ten man raids.

Etc...|||At L80, before you CAN do heroics, you need to gear up a tiny bit in non-heroic L80 5-mans. There's a gear-check built-in.
